Результаты поиска по запросу "deadlock"
Как я могу вызвать тупик в MySQL для целей тестирования
Я хочу, чтобы моя библиотека Python, работающая с MySQLdb, могла обнаруживать тупики и пытаться снова. Я считаю, что я разработал хорошее решение, и теперь я...
Согласитесь с @ davidk01, что это не тупик. И это, конечно, не «классический» пример, если бы он был. Просто для дополнительной информации, даже без запуска потока, вызов метода в java, который синхронизирован с той же блокировкой, которую уже удерживает поток, не будет блокироваться, так как вызывающая сторона уже владеет блокировкой.
оложим, я выполняюsynchronized блок кода внутри некоторого потока и внутриsynchronized block Я вызываю метод, который порождает другой поток для обработки синхронизированного блока кода, который требует такой же блокировки, как и первый метод. ...
Образец тупика в .net?
Кто-нибудь может дать простой пример кода Deadlock в C #? И, пожалуйста, расскажите самый простой способ найти тупик в вашем примере кода на C #. (Может быть...
Я бы использовал механизм Monitor для достижения приостановки и возобновления потоков. Monitor.Wait заставит поток ждать Monitor.Pulse.
м приложении я выполняю чтение моего файла другим потоком (кроме этого потока с графическим интерфейсом). Есть две кнопки, которые приостанавливают и возобновляют поток соответственно. private void BtnStopAutoUpd_Click(object sender, EventArgs ...
От чего зависит порядок блокировки многостолового запроса?
Указывает ли стандарт SQL порядок блокировки для многотабличного запроса? Например, учитывая: SELECT department.id FROM permissions, terminals, departments WHERE department.id = ? AND terminal.id = ? AND permissions.parent = department.id ...
await работает, но вызывает задачу. Результат зависает / блокируется
У меня есть следующие четыре теста и последний зависает, когда я запускаю его, мой вопрос, почему это происходит: [Test] public void CheckOnceResultTest() { Assert.IsTrue(CheckStatus().Result); } [Test] public async void CheckOnceAwaitTest() { ...
Python multiprocessing.Queue взаимоблокировки на пут и получить
У меня проблемы с тупиком с этим фрагментом кода: